6+ Easy Ways to Uninstall Android Studio in Mac


6+ Easy Ways to Uninstall Android Studio in Mac

The method of fully eradicating the built-in improvement setting, Android Studio, from a macOS working system is a multi-stage process. This motion ensures all related recordsdata, configurations, and dependencies are purged from the system to reclaim disk house and forestall conflicts with future installations or different software program. This entire elimination extends past merely dragging the appliance icon to the Trash.

Endeavor this process is important for customers looking for to resolve set up points, unlock cupboard space consumed by the appliance and its elements, or put together their system for a clear set up of a more moderen model. Traditionally, improper or incomplete elimination might result in persistent issues with system efficiency and software program compatibility. Due to this fact, a radical strategy is extremely beneficial.

The following dialogue particulars the exact steps vital to realize a whole and correct elimination, encompassing utility deletion, desire file elimination, emulator knowledge elimination, and associated configuration recordsdata, in order that the working system is rid of all elements of Android Studio.

1. Software Deletion

Software deletion constitutes the preliminary, but inadequate, step within the full elimination of Android Studio from a macOS system. Whereas dragging the appliance icon to the Trash seems simple, it leaves behind quite a few supporting recordsdata and configurations that may influence system efficiency and future installations. A complete elimination requires addressing these residual elements.

  • Preliminary Step, Incomplete Answer

    Transferring the Android Studio utility to the Trash solely removes the core program recordsdata. It doesn’t take away related SDKs, emulator pictures, Gradle caches, or user-specific preferences. Due to this fact, whereas vital, this motion is merely the place to begin and never everything of the elimination course of.

  • Influence on Disk Area

    Failure to take away related recordsdata means important disk house stays occupied. Android Studio’s SDKs, emulator pictures, and Gradle caches can collectively devour gigabytes of storage. Deleting solely the appliance leaves this substantial knowledge footprint intact.

  • Potential for Battle

    Leaving configuration recordsdata and preferences in place can create conflicts if a person later reinstalls Android Studio. These leftover recordsdata could intrude with the brand new set up, resulting in sudden habits or errors. A radical elimination mitigates this threat.

  • Making certain System Stability

    Residual recordsdata, particularly these associated to system-level configurations, can influence general system stability. Though the speedy impact could also be minimal, the buildup of orphaned recordsdata from a number of purposes can degrade efficiency over time. A clear elimination contributes to sustaining a steady working setting.

In abstract, whereas utility deletion initiates the method of eradicating Android Studio from macOS, its effectiveness is restricted. A complete uninstallation necessitates addressing the varied supplementary recordsdata and configurations related to the appliance to make sure full elimination, reclaim disk house, forestall conflicts, and preserve system stability. Subsequent steps, reminiscent of eradicating preferences and emulator knowledge, are essential to reaching this aim.

2. Preferences Removing

The elimination of desire recordsdata constitutes a important facet of the whole utility elimination course of from macOS. Preferences, saved as .plist recordsdata, include user-specific settings and configurations that Android Studio makes use of. Failure to eradicate these recordsdata can result in sudden habits upon reinstallation or conflicts with different software program.

  • Location and Identification

    Desire recordsdata are usually positioned throughout the `~/Library/Preferences` listing. Recordsdata related to Android Studio often embrace identifiers reminiscent of `com.google.android.studio.plist` or related variations incorporating the appliance’s title and model. Correct identification is essential to keep away from unintended deletion of unrelated desire recordsdata.

  • Content material and Perform

    These recordsdata retailer a spread of settings, together with UI customizations, editor configurations, and project-specific preferences. Removing ensures a contemporary begin upon reinstallation, stopping the carryover of probably corrupted or outdated settings. For instance, a person may need custom-made the IDE’s look, keyboard shortcuts, or code completion habits; these settings are preserved within the preferences recordsdata.

  • Influence on Reinstallation

    Leaving desire recordsdata intact may end up in the brand new set up adopting earlier settings, which can be undesirable if the person is making an attempt to resolve configuration points. It could possibly additionally result in conflicts if the format or construction of the desire recordsdata has modified between variations of Android Studio. A clear slate, achieved via desire elimination, is usually beneficial.

  • Process for Removing

    Removing entails navigating to the `~/Library/Preferences` listing utilizing Finder or Terminal and deleting the related .plist recordsdata. Warning is suggested to keep away from deleting system-level desire recordsdata or these belonging to different purposes. A backup of the desire recordsdata could be created previous to deletion as a precautionary measure.

See also  8+ Best Android 10.1 Car Stereo: Upgrade Now!

In conclusion, the systematic elimination of desire recordsdata is a vital step within the strategy of fully eradicating Android Studio from macOS. It ensures a clear reinstallation expertise, avoids potential conflicts arising from outdated configurations, and contributes to sustaining system stability by eliminating pointless recordsdata. Whereas seemingly minor, the omission of this step can undermine the effectiveness of the general utility elimination effort.

3. Emulator Information

Emulator knowledge, within the context of Android Studio on macOS, represents a good portion of the appliance’s storage footprint. This knowledge, generated and saved by digital Android gadgets, necessitates cautious consideration through the uninstallation course of to make sure full elimination and reclamation of disk house.

  • Storage Consumption

    Emulator knowledge includes system pictures, person knowledge partitions, and snapshots, all contributing to substantial storage calls for. A single emulator can simply devour a number of gigabytes of disk house. Incomplete uninstallation, neglecting this knowledge, ends in a big quantity of orphaned storage.

  • Location and Identification

    Emulator knowledge usually resides throughout the `~/.android/avd` listing on macOS. Every Android Digital System (AVD) has a devoted folder containing its related knowledge. Right identification of those AVD folders is essential for focused elimination, stopping unintended deletion of unrelated recordsdata.

  • Removing Process

    Correct elimination entails deleting the contents of the `~/.android/avd` listing, or selectively eradicating particular person AVD folders utilizing the Android Digital System Supervisor (AVD Supervisor) inside Android Studio (if the appliance remains to be useful). Alternatively, command-line instruments reminiscent of `rm -rf ~/.android/avd` could be employed, exercising warning to keep away from knowledge loss.

  • Influence on System Efficiency

    Whereas the presence of emulator knowledge doesn’t instantly influence system efficiency when the emulators should not working, its storage consumption can contribute to general disk house limitations. Inadequate disk house can not directly have an effect on system responsiveness. Full elimination alleviates this concern.

The entire elimination of emulator knowledge is, due to this fact, a vital part of the Android Studio uninstallation course of on macOS. It ensures that each one related recordsdata are eradicated, liberating up disk house, and stopping potential conflicts with future installations or different purposes. Addressing this aspect contributes to a clear and thorough uninstallation.

4. SDK Areas

The correct uninstallation of Android Studio on macOS necessitates addressing the Software program Growth Equipment (SDK) areas, as these elements should not mechanically eliminated when the appliance is deleted. Neglecting these areas ends in a substantial quantity of cupboard space remaining occupied and doubtlessly interfering with future Android improvement environments.

  • Identification of SDK Paths

    Android Studio permits customization of the SDK set up path. The default location is usually throughout the person’s house listing, typically below `~/Library/Android/sdk` or a equally named listing. Figuring out the right SDK paths is important earlier than continuing with the uninstallation. Examination of the `native.properties` file inside Android tasks can reveal the explicitly outlined SDK path. Incomplete identification can result in incomplete elimination.

  • Dimension and Scope of SDK Elements

    The SDK encompasses important instruments, platforms, and construct instruments required for Android improvement. Elements embrace the Android platform instruments, construct instruments, platform APIs for numerous Android variations, and emulator pictures. Every API degree can devour a big quantity of disk house. Failure to take away these elements renders the uninstallation incomplete and leaves a considerable knowledge footprint.

  • Removing Course of and Implications

    The elimination of the SDK listing entails manually deleting the recognized SDK folder. This may be achieved via Finder or the command line. After deletion, the SDK setting variables (e.g., `ANDROID_HOME`) ought to be unset to stop different purposes from referencing the non-existent SDK. Improper dealing with throughout this part can disrupt different improvement instruments or scripts that depend on these variables.

  • Influence on Future Installations

    Residual SDK directories could cause conflicts when putting in a brand new model of Android Studio or different Android improvement instruments. The installer would possibly detect the prevailing SDK and try to reuse it, doubtlessly resulting in compatibility points or sudden habits. A clear elimination of SDK areas ensures a contemporary and constant set up course of for future Android improvement endeavors.

The great elimination of SDK areas is due to this fact a compulsory step within the full uninstallation of Android Studio on macOS. It not solely frees up substantial disk house but in addition ensures a clear slate for future installations, mitigating potential conflicts and inconsistencies. A radical strategy to SDK elimination contributes considerably to a steady and predictable improvement setting.

5. Gradle Cache

The Gradle cache, a repository of downloaded dependencies and construct outputs, performs a vital function within the software program improvement lifecycle inside Android Studio. Through the strategy of eradicating Android Studio from macOS, the presence and measurement of this cache warrant particular consideration to make sure a whole and efficient uninstallation.

See also  Best Kinston Android 11 Gaming Tablet (103SD-L Grey)

  • Function and Perform of the Gradle Cache

    The Gradle cache optimizes construct instances by storing beforehand downloaded dependencies and generated construct artifacts. This prevents redundant downloads and recompilations, accelerating the construct course of. Nonetheless, over time, the cache can accumulate a big quantity of knowledge, consuming substantial disk house. When uninstalling Android Studio, this accrued cache stays until explicitly eliminated.

  • Location of the Gradle Cache on macOS

    The Gradle cache is usually positioned within the person’s house listing below `~/.gradle/caches`. This listing accommodates cached dependencies, construct outputs, and different Gradle-related recordsdata. Its exact measurement can differ considerably based mostly on the variety of tasks constructed and the dependencies used. Correct identification of this location is important for efficient cache elimination.

  • Influence on Disk Area and System Assets

    The Gradle cache can simply develop to a number of gigabytes in measurement, notably when engaged on a number of Android tasks with various dependencies. Failing to take away the cache throughout uninstallation leaves this storage occupied, doubtlessly impacting general system efficiency and out there disk house. Its elimination contributes on to reclaiming storage sources.

  • Process for Eradicating the Gradle Cache

    The Gradle cache could be eliminated manually by deleting the `~/.gradle/caches` listing utilizing Finder or the command line. Alternatively, Gradle offers duties that may clear the cache. Through the uninstallation course of, confirming the elimination of this listing is essential to make sure a whole and thorough elimination of Android Studio and its related elements from the macOS setting.

Due to this fact, acknowledging the Gradle cache and implementing its elimination as a part of the whole Android Studio uninstallation process on macOS is important to reclaim important disk house and forestall potential useful resource conflicts sooner or later. A radical uninstallation process contains the express deletion of the Gradle cache, making certain a clear system state after elimination.

6. Configuration Recordsdata

Configuration recordsdata, within the context of fully eradicating Android Studio from a macOS system, symbolize a vital, typically missed, part. These recordsdata retailer numerous settings, preferences, and project-specific configurations that Android Studio makes use of throughout operation. Their persistence after the first utility recordsdata are deleted can result in problems, together with residual setting conflicts and incomplete system cleanup. For instance, project-specific settings associated to SDK paths or construct configurations saved in configuration recordsdata can intrude with subsequent Android improvement environments if not eliminated, inflicting construct errors or sudden habits. The existence and proper administration of the configuration recordsdata performs a big function on uninstall android studio in mac, because it instantly impacts if it is fully eliminated or not.

Examples of those configuration recordsdata embrace `.gradle` settings, project-specific `.thought` directories, and environment-specific property recordsdata. These recordsdata can dictate facets reminiscent of the placement of the Android SDK, the construct device model, and signing configurations. Neglecting to take away these recordsdata may end up in sudden habits when a brand new model of Android Studio is put in or when completely different Android improvement instruments are used. Moreover, sure configuration recordsdata could include delicate data, reminiscent of API keys or signing credentials. Leaving these recordsdata on the system after the meant utility elimination presents a possible safety threat. In sensible phrases, a developer would possibly expertise construct failures or configuration errors in new tasks if these residual settings should not cleared. The significance of eradicating these recordsdata can’t be overstated whenever you uninstall android studio in mac.

In abstract, the whole and correct elimination of Android Studio on macOS necessitates the thorough deletion of related configuration recordsdata. These recordsdata, whereas typically small in measurement, can have a big influence on the steadiness and cleanliness of the system. Eradicating these configuration recordsdata mitigates potential conflicts, ensures the whole reclamation of disk house, and contributes to the general integrity of the event setting. The failure to handle configuration recordsdata represents an incomplete strategy to utility elimination, doubtlessly resulting in persistent points for the person. Their correct dealing with is integral to the uninstall android studio in mac course of, making certain no traces of the system are left.

Continuously Requested Questions

The next addresses widespread inquiries relating to the whole elimination of Android Studio from a macOS setting, making certain all associated elements are eradicated.

Query 1: Why is merely dragging the appliance to the Trash not enough for full elimination?

Dragging the appliance icon to the Trash solely removes the core program recordsdata. It doesn’t eradicate related SDKs, emulator pictures, Gradle caches, user-specific preferences, or configuration recordsdata, which occupy important disk house and may trigger conflicts upon reinstallation.

See also  Accessing Cricket Voicemail Number on Android: 3+ Ways

Query 2: The place are Android Studio preferences saved, and why should they be eliminated?

Desire recordsdata are positioned within the `~/Library/Preferences` listing. They include user-specific settings and configurations. Removing ensures a contemporary begin upon reinstallation and prevents conflicts arising from outdated or corrupted settings.

Query 3: How a lot disk house can emulator knowledge occupy, and the way is it correctly eliminated?

Emulator knowledge can devour a number of gigabytes of disk house per emulator. It’s usually positioned within the `~/.android/avd` listing. Removing entails deleting the contents of this listing or utilizing the AVD Supervisor inside Android Studio to take away particular person emulators.

Query 4: What are SDK areas, and why is their elimination vital?

SDK areas confer with the directories the place the Android Software program Growth Equipment is put in. These directories include important instruments and platform APIs. Their elimination is important to reclaim disk house and forestall conflicts throughout future installations.

Query 5: What’s the Gradle cache, and why ought to it’s deleted?

The Gradle cache shops downloaded dependencies and construct outputs to optimize construct instances. It could possibly develop to a number of gigabytes. Deleting the cache frees up disk house and prevents potential conflicts throughout reinstallation or when utilizing completely different variations of Gradle.

Query 6: What sorts of configuration recordsdata ought to be eliminated through the uninstallation course of?

Configuration recordsdata embrace `.gradle` settings, project-specific `.thought` directories, and environment-specific property recordsdata (e.g., `native.properties`). These recordsdata retailer undertaking settings and configurations and ought to be eliminated to make sure a clear and constant setting.

Full elimination of Android Studio from macOS requires addressing all related elements. Failure to take action may end up in wasted disk house, potential conflicts, and an incomplete uninstallation.

The previous dialogue has detailed the particular steps to make sure a radical elimination. The following article part offers a step-by-step information of performing this job.

Knowledgeable Steering

This part presents centered recommendation for reaching a whole and profitable elimination, addressing potential pitfalls and making certain a clear system state.

Tip 1: Confirm Software Closure: Affirm that Android Studio and all related processes (e.g., emulators, ADB) are terminated earlier than initiating the elimination course of. Use Exercise Monitor to determine and stop any lingering processes to keep away from file entry conflicts throughout deletion.

Tip 2: Backup Vital Undertaking Information: Previous to uninstalling, again up any important tasks or configuration recordsdata. Whereas the uninstallation course of goals to take away solely application-related elements, a precautionary backup safeguards in opposition to unintended knowledge loss.

Tip 3: Make the most of the Command Line for Exact Removing: Make use of command-line instruments (e.g., `rm -rf`) with warning and precision when eradicating directories just like the Gradle cache or SDK areas. Double-check paths to stop unintended deletion of unrelated recordsdata. Think about using tab completion to make sure accuracy.

Tip 4: Examine Hidden Directories: Make sure that hidden directories (these beginning with a `.`) within the person’s house listing are completely inspected for Android Studio-related recordsdata or folders. Use the `ls -a` command in Terminal to disclose these hidden gadgets.

Tip 5: Unset Surroundings Variables: After eradicating the SDK, unset any setting variables (e.g., `ANDROID_HOME`, `ANDROID_SDK_ROOT`) outlined within the `.bash_profile`, `.zshrc`, or related shell configuration recordsdata. This prevents different purposes from referencing the non-existent SDK.

Tip 6: Examine for System-Degree Elements: Look at `/Library/LaunchAgents` and `/Library/LaunchDaemons` for any Android Studio-related launch brokers or daemons. Eradicating these ensures no background processes related to the appliance stay energetic.

Tip 7: Evaluation Put in Plugins and Dependencies: Earlier than uninstalling, doc any customized plugins or dependencies put in inside Android Studio. This data could be helpful when organising a brand new improvement setting sooner or later, to recall beforehand used device units.

Adhering to those tips will improve the probability of a whole and profitable elimination, mitigating potential points and making certain a clear system setting.

The next step-by-step directions will present a complete course of to reaching a whole uninstallation to correctly deal with the necessity to uninstall android studio in mac.

Conclusion

This exploration has meticulously outlined the method of fully eradicating Android Studio from a macOS setting. The dialogue emphasised that profitable uninstallation extends far past merely deleting the appliance icon. It requires the deliberate elimination of desire recordsdata, emulator knowledge, SDK areas, Gradle caches, and related configuration recordsdata, every of which contributes to the general storage footprint and potential for future conflicts.

Adherence to the detailed steps and knowledgeable steering offered herein is paramount to making sure a clear, steady, and conflict-free system. The diligent execution of those procedures safeguards in opposition to persistent points and promotes optimum efficiency for subsequent software program installations or improvement endeavors. Neglecting these essential steps dangers perpetuating inefficiencies and hindering the integrity of the macOS setting.

Leave a Comment